Akshay Kumar to renounce Canadian passport, says 'India is everything to me, fortunate to get chance to give back'

Akshay Kumar has always been under fire over his Canadian citizenship. The actor who is gearing up for the release of his upcoming film, Selfiee, made a strong revelation about his citizenship. The actor shared that he has applied for a change of passport.

The 55-year-old star appeared in the first episode of the new season of Seedhi Baat on Aaj Tak and made some shocking revelations about his Canadian citizenship. The actor, who is constantly criticised for having a Canadian passport, told the leading media that he has applied for one and will renounce the same in order to prove his love for his country, India.

Ganpath Part 1 Teaser: Tiger Shroff-Kriti Sanon Starrer To Release On October 20

Tiger Shroff and Kriti Sanon starrer Ganpath is all set to hit the theatres in October 2023. Taking it to Instagram, Tiger shared an action-packed announcement teaser of Ganpath, where he can be seen in a rugged avatar. The movie also stars Amitabh Bachchan in a pivotal role. An out-and-out sports drama, read on to know more about Tiger and Kriti`s upcoming movie. 

Tiger Shroff took to his Instagram account and shared the announcement teaser of his upcoming sports-drama Ganpath. He can be seen donning the rugged MMA fighter look. Collaborating with his co-star Kriti Sanon, Ganpath marks the duo`s second project together after their debut movie Heropanti.

Gadar 2: Makers of Sunny Deol and Ameesha Patel starrer reveal the villain

Sunny Deol and Ameesha Patel’s Gadar: Ek Prem Katha is coming back with a sequel Gadar 2 after its tremendous success. The upcoming film Gadar 2 is stuffed with spectacular performances and action scenes. 

You will be surprised to know that the renowned actor Rohit Choudhary is going to play the role of the villain in the upcoming sequel. And the antagonist recently revealed some crispy deets about Gadar 2. The actor said that earlier he was assigned a small part in the film but his role got extended after director Anil Sharma liked his work and dedication.

How Bollywood actor Govinda’s acting career ended

Bollywood’s celebrated actor Govinda and his love for the comedy genre has no boundaries. He surely reminds people of the King of Comedy movies he contributed to more than 100 Hindi films. He made his debut in the film industry in 1986 with the film Ilzaam and since he has appeared in over 165 movies like Dulhe Raja, Sandwich, Bade Miyan Chote Miyan, Bhagam Bhag, Hero No.1, and many others. In that decade, he made all of his immensely popular movies.

However, his career began to decline after 2000 because he didn’t make many discoveries. He is one of India’s most varied actors, yet he chose to stick to doing the same old things instead of trying to take advantage of his versatility. The environment has begun to change.
